Compensation Disclosure and Privacy Statements
SevenHills Benefit Partners is a Minnesota based independent insurance agency licensed to sell and service life and health insurance products in multiple States. As independent agents, neither SevenHills Benefit Partners nor its agents have employment agreements or exclusive marketing agreements with any health plan or insurance company (carrier). This affords us greater ability to be objective when recommending products to our clients.
SevenHills Benefit Partners is compensated by commissions and/or by fees. In general, commission compensation is included in the premium price for the insurance coverage and paid to us by the insurance carrier. Fee based compensation may be either billed separately from premiums or included in the premium. SevenHills Benefit Partners is happy to provide information to clients on their specific arrangement.
Premiums for many small group and individual health insurance products are calculated and filed with State agencies with a standard commission included in the filed rate. This means that costs for the services of SevenHills Benefit Partners and its agents for these products are included in the premiums. In these situations if a buyer chooses not to use an agency, the premium costs to the insured would be unchanged.
In addition to regular commissions, SevenHills Benefit Partners may become eligible for supplemental or contingent compensation. Insurance companies may pay additional compensation if certain volume, growth or retention goals are achieved. These types of retrospective programs vary considerably and are not guaranteed. They also typically are based on the total amount of agency business placed with the carrier, not on an individual policy basis. Because of these programs, SevenHills Benefit Partners may be considered to have a financial incentive to place coverage with a particular insurance company.
